In a world where magic is a part of everyday life, Tsunami, a young witch with curly red hair, bright green eyes, and distinctive glasses, is poised to embark on an extraordinary journey. Born with a mysterious mark on her collarbone, a mirror image of her twin brother's lightning-shaped scar, she's one half of the legendary Twins Who Lived. Raised by the strict and demanding Severus Snape, Tsunami has grown up surrounded by the Dark Arts and has formed a strong bond with her best friend and confidant, Draco Malfoy. As she prepares to leave her childhood behind, Tsunami is reunited with her long-lost twin brother, Harry, who has been living with the Dursleys. Harry's experiences have been vastly different from Tsunami's, marked by neglect and isolation. But as they begin their journey together at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ry, they're faced with a new challenge: Harry is sorted into Gryffindor House, while Tsunami in Slytherin. As they navigate their different paths, Tsunami must balance her loyalty to her twin with her existing friendships and alliances, particularly with Draco. Meanwhile, Harry must confront his own destiny and learn to trust others, after a lifetime of solitude. As the Twins Who Lived, they're destined for greatness, but their differing upbringings and personalities threaten to drive them apart. Can they find a way to reconcile their differences and forge a lasting bond, or will their rival houses and conflicting loyalties tear them apart?

Synopsis: Drake Lucien Malfoy, born mere minutes after his infamous twin, Draco, has always been the quieter, more enigmatic brother. Bearing the same striking platinum-blonde hair and pale, aristocratic features that mark the Malfoy lineage, Drake possesses an undeniable, almost ethereal handsomeness that even Draco secretly envies. Unlike his brother, who was raised steeped in pure-blood supremacy within the hallowed halls of Malfoy Manor, Drake was sent across the Atlantic at a young age, enrolled in the prestigious American wizarding school, Ilvermorny. There, he cultivated a sharp intellect and a subtle charm, far removed from the overt arrogance of his twin. Now, in their third year, a sudden, cryptic summons from Lucius Malfoy forces Drake to transfer to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ry. His arrival sends ripples through the ancient castle. To the students, he's an anomaly - a Malfoy, yet not quite a Malfoy. To the teachers, he's a puzzle, his Ilvermorny education clashing with Hogwarts traditions. And to Draco, he's an unwelcome shadow, a constant reminder of a path not taken, and a challenge to his established dominance. As Drake navigates the treacherous social landscape of Slytherin House, he quickly discovers that Hogwarts is far more than just a school. Whispers of dark magic, unsettling disappearances, and a series of increasingly dangerous "accidents" plague the corridors. He finds himself drawn into a web of ancient mysteries, some tied to the very foundations of Hogwarts, others hinting at a deeper, more sinister plot connected to the rising power of the dark Lord. With his unique perspective and unconventional magical training, Drake must unravel the chaos, all while contending with his brother's simmering resentment, the suspicions of Dumbledore, and the ever-present shadow of his family's dark legacy. Can he uncover the truth before Hogwarts succumbs to the encroaching darkness, or will he, too, be consumed by the serpent's shadow?
